Codex Multi-Account

Zwei Codex-Konten.
Eine AgentsRoom. Null Shell-Tricks.

Ein persönliches Codex CLI-Login auf einem Projekt, ein geschäftliches auf einem anderen, im selben Fenster, gleichzeitig. Ein Codex-Konto pro Projekt festlegen. Pro Agent überschreiben, wenn nötig. Direkt über das Einstellungs-Panel anmelden, ohne CODEX_HOME-Exporte oder zusätzliche Tools.

AgentsRoom Multiple Accounts Panel in den Einstellungen mit Claude- und Codex-Tabs, einem Codex Work-Konto und einem Codex Personal-Konto inklusive Anmeldestatus-Badges

Das Multiple Accounts Panel in den Einstellungen, vereint für Claude und Codex. Wähle ein Codex-Konto pro Projekt und pro Agent.

Warum mehrere Codex-Konten nutzen

Echte Gründe, warum Entwickler mehr als ein Codex-Konto verwenden, klar erklärt.

Arbeit und Privates sauber trennen

Das Codex-Konto des Arbeitgebers bleibt bei den Arbeitsprojekten. Das persönliche OpenAI-Konto bleibt bei den Wochenendprojekten. Keine versehentliche Vermischung von Prompts, keine geschäftlichen Zugangsdaten in einem Nebenprojekt, keine persönlichen Sessions auf dem Geschäftskonto.

Verbrauch pro Kunde abrechnen

Wenn ein Kunde Codex-Zugang bereitstellt, laufen dessen Sessions auf seinem Konto. Seine Tokens werden verbraucht, nicht deine. Jedes Konto hat seine eigene Nutzungshistorie, sodass die Abrechnung unkompliziert bleibt.

Kontingent-Kollisionen vermeiden

Hat das Geschäftskonto ein enges OpenAI-Kontingent, verbraucht ein langer Agent-Lauf auf einem persönlichen Wochenendprojekt davon nichts. Jedes Konto hat seine eigenen Limits, seinen eigenen Rate-Limiting-Status, seine eigene Nutzungshistorie.

Test-Konto neben Prod-Konto betreiben

Ein separates Codex-Konto für Experimente, Wegwerf-Agenten und Prompt-Entwürfe anlegen. Das Prod-Konto sauber halten. Mit zwei Klicks pro Agent oder Projekt zwischen beiden wechseln.

Verschiedene Orgs, verschiedene Richtlinien

Manche OpenAI-Konten sind an Enterprise-SSO mit verpflichtendem Logging oder Telemetrie gebunden. Ein separates persönliches Konto stellt sicher, dass das eigene Coding auf eigenen Bedingungen bleibt, isoliert auf Verzeichnisebene auf der Festplatte.

Pair Coding für zwei Personen an einem Rechner

Teilen sich zwei Entwickler gelegentlich einen Arbeitsplatz, kann sich jeder mit seinem eigenen Codex-Konto anmelden. AgentsRoom merkt sich beide, und je nach Projekt oder Agent wird das richtige gestartet.

Direkt in AgentsRoom integriert

Kein externer Switcher, keine Shell-Skripte, kein Logout-Login-Tanz.

Ein Codex-Konto pro Projekt

Ein Codex-Konto an ein Projekt heften. Alle Agenten in diesem Projekt erben es standardmäßig. Ein Work-Projekt und ein Personal-Projekt im selben Fenster öffnen, jedes läuft mit seinem eigenen Codex-Konto.

Pro Agent überschreiben

Einen einzelnen Agenten auf einem anderen Konto benötigt? Agenten bearbeiten, ein anderes Codex-Konto auswählen, speichern. Die Überschreibung gilt nur für diesen Agenten. Der Rest des Projekts behält das Konto auf Projektebene.

Direkt in der App anmelden

"Konto hinzufügen" anklicken und AgentsRoom öffnet ein eingebettetes Mini-Terminal, das codex login mit dem richtigen CODEX_HOME ausführt. Den OAuth-Flow im Browser abschließen, den Code zurückeinfügen. Das Status-Badge wechselt zu "Angemeldet", sobald die Zugangsdaten auf der Festplatte sind.

Globales Standard-Konto

Ein Codex-Konto als globalen Standard festlegen. Jedes neue Projekt startet mit diesem Konto, sofern nicht überschrieben. Den Standard später ändern und alle nicht fixierten Projekte folgen automatisch.

Strikte Isolation auf der Festplatte

Jedes Konto lebt in seinem eigenen, durch CODEX_HOME gesteuerten Verzeichnis: Tokens, Sessions, Konfiguration. Zwei Konten teilen sich nie eine Datei. Das Löschen eines Kontos in AgentsRoom berührt niemals die Daten eines anderen Kontos.

Wie es unter der Haube funktioniert

Basiert auf dem offiziellen Multi-Account-Mechanismus von Codex CLI.

01

CODEX_HOME steuert alles

Codex CLI liest Tokens und Konfiguration aus dem Verzeichnis, auf das CODEX_HOME zeigt. Standard ist ~/.codex. Diese Variable auf ein anderes Verzeichnis zu setzen, wechselt das aktive Konto. AgentsRoom nutzt diesen offiziellen Mechanismus für die Multi-Account-Unterstützung.

02

Jedes Konto ist ein verwaltetes Verzeichnis

Beim Klick auf "Konto hinzufügen" erstellt AgentsRoom ~/.agentsroom/codex-profiles/<id>/ und meldet sich dort an. Ein Konto kann auch auf einen bestehenden Codex-Konfigurationsordner durch Eingabe eines benutzerdefinierten Pfads zeigen.

03

Anmelde-Flow ist in den Einstellungen eingebettet

AgentsRoom startet ein Mini-PTY, das codex login mit CODEX_HOME für das neue Profilverzeichnis ausführt. OAuth im Browser abschließen, Code zurückeinfügen. AgentsRoom fragt auth.json einmal pro Sekunde ab, sodass das "Angemeldet"-Badge erscheint, sobald die Datei auf der Festplatte landet.

04

Kaskadierte Auflösung beim Start

Beim Start eines Agenten löst AgentsRoom das effektive Codex-Konto in dieser Reihenfolge auf: Agenten-Override, Projekt-Pin, Einstellungs-Standard, System-Standard ~/.codex. Das richtige CODEX_HOME wird in der PTY-Umgebung gesetzt, bevor Codex startet.

Alternativen zu AgentsRoom

Andere Wege zur Verwaltung mehrerer Codex-Konten und was AgentsRoom anders macht.

CODEX_HOME manuell

Der direkte Weg: CODEX_HOME=/pfad vor dem Start von Codex exportieren. Manuell, fehleranfällig, und sobald ein zweiter Terminal-Tab geöffnet wird, verliert man den Überblick, welches Konto aktiv ist. AgentsRoom steuert diese Variable automatisch, pro Projekt und pro Agent, und zeigt das aktive Konto jederzeit im Picker an.

Zwei separate Rechner oder zwei Benutzersitzungen

Manche Teams nutzen einen separaten Rechner oder eine separate OS-Benutzersitzung pro Codex-Konto. Schwerfällig, langsam, und ein Work-Agent und ein Personal-Agent können nicht parallel laufen. AgentsRoom betreibt beide gleichzeitig auf demselben Rechner, im selben Fenster.

Jedes Mal aus- und einloggen

codex logout ausführen, dann codex login auf dem neuen Konto, dann wieder zurückwechseln. Kostet Minuten pro Wechsel und unterbricht laufende Sessions. AgentsRoom hält alle Konten dauerhaft angemeldet, Wechsel per Klick.

Shell-Skripte, die codex login umhüllen

Manche Entwickler umhüllen Codex mit einer Shell-Funktion, die CODEX_HOME anhand des aktuellen Verzeichnisses exportiert. Fragil, handgestrickt und aus der IDE unsichtbar. AgentsRoom codiert dieselbe Idee deklarativ auf Projektebene, mit einem UI-Badge, das immer das aktive Konto anzeigt.

Was AgentsRoom kann, was die anderen nicht können

AgentsRoom ist die einzige IDE, die mehrere Codex-Konten als erstklassiges Konzept behandelt: mit einem Projekt-Pin, einem Agenten-Override, einem In-App-Anmelde-Flow via codex login und einem Status-Badge pro Konto. Einmal pro Konto anmelden, Konten pro Projekt festlegen, pro Agent überschreiben, und keine Gedanken mehr machen, welches Konto geladen ist. Mehrere Codex-Konten UND Claude-Konten im selben Fenster: ein Codex Work-Agent, ein Codex Personal-Agent und ein Claude-Agent können alle parallel laufen.

FAQ

Wie viele Codex-Konten kann ich AgentsRoom hinzufügen?

Es gibt kein hartes Limit. Jedes Konto ist ein Verzeichnis auf der Festplatte. Work-Konto, Personal-Konto, ein Konto pro Kunde, ein Test-Konto hinzufügen: AgentsRoom listet sie alle im Einstellungs-Panel auf und lässt pro Projekt oder Agent jedes beliebige auswählen.

Muss ich ein zusätzliches Tool installieren, um mehrere Codex-Konten in AgentsRoom zu nutzen?

Nein. AgentsRoom steuert den CODEX_HOME-Mechanismus von Codex CLI direkt. Kein externer Switcher, kein Shell-Wrapper, keine zusätzliche Abhängigkeit. Der Anmelde-Flow ist vollständig in das Einstellungs-Panel eingebettet und führt den offiziellen Befehl codex login aus.

Können zwei verschiedene Agenten im selben Projekt gleichzeitig auf zwei verschiedenen Codex-Konten laufen?

Ja. Das Projekt legt ein Standard-Konto fest, aber jeder Agent kann es überschreiben. Ein auf dem Work-Konto fixiertes Projekt öffnen, einen bestimmten Agenten auf das Personal-Konto setzen, und die beiden Agenten laufen parallel auf verschiedenen Codex-Konten im selben Fenster.

Was passiert, wenn ich ein Konto lösche, auf das einige Agenten noch verweisen?

Nichts bricht. Die Agenten fallen lautlos auf das Standard-Codex-Konto zurück. Das gelöschte Verzeichnis bleibt auf der Festplatte, falls es später als Basis für ein anderes Profil genutzt werden soll. Die verwaisten Agenten können jederzeit im Agent-bearbeiten-Dialog einem anderen Konto zugewiesen werden.

Werden Zugangsdaten mit anderen AgentsRoom-Nutzern geteilt oder an einen Server gesendet?

Nein. Jedes Kontoverzeichnis bleibt auf dem lokalen Rechner. AgentsRoom liest, kopiert oder überträgt niemals Zugangsdaten. Der Anmelde-Flow führt das offizielle codex login CLI in einem lokalen PTY aus, OAuth läuft wie gewohnt zwischen OpenAI und dem Browser.

Kann ich Claude-Konten und Codex-Konten im selben Projekt mischen?

Ja. Das Multiple Accounts Panel in den Einstellungen verwaltet Claude- und Codex-Konten unabhängig voneinander. Ein einzelnes Projekt kann ein Claude-Konto und ein Codex-Konto gleichzeitig fixiert haben. Jeder Agent nutzt den Provider und das Konto, für das er konfiguriert ist.

Gleiche Idee, anderer Provider

Könnte dich auch interessieren: Claude Multi-Account

Mehrere Codex-Konten bieten verschiedene Codex-Logins in einer App. Claude Multi-Account macht dasselbe für Claude Code: ein Work-Claude-Konto, ein Personal-Claude-Konto und ein Kunden-Claude-Konto parallel betreiben. Beide Features leben im selben Multiple Accounts Panel in den AgentsRoom-Einstellungen.

Claude Multi-Account Feature ansehen

Schluss mit dem Jonglieren von Shell-Variablen. Konto aus dem Picker wählen.

Heute ein Work-Codex-Konto, ein Personal-Codex-Konto und ein Kunden-Konto in AgentsRoom, nebeneinander, betreiben.

KostenlosAgentsRoom herunterladen

Companion-App: Agenten auch unterwegs im Blick behalten

Nutzen Sie Claude, Codex, Gemini CLI oder einen anderen AI-Anbieter.

Erweiterung installieren
Chrome Web Store

Bugs und Wünsche direkt in dein öffentliches Backlog schicken.

Ein Blick auf AgentsRoom in Aktion.

Multi-Projekte
Multi-Provider
Multi-Agenten
Live-Status
Diff & Commit
Mobile App
Live-Vorschau
Agent-Teams
Browser-Tests
Backlog-getriebene Entwicklung
Prompt-Bibliothek
Skills-Bibliothek
Alle Funktionen ansehen